Understanding LED Tape Strip Lighting
LED tape strip lighting has revolutionized the way we illuminate spaces. This innovative lighting solution offers flexibility and versatility, making it suitable for a myriad of applications, from residential to commercial settings. Its slim profile allows for easy installation in various locations, such as under cabinets, along staircases, or in coves, providing a seamless and uniform light distribution.
The ‘tape’ in LED tape strip comes from the adhesive backing that allows for effortless mounting on surfaces. Thanks to its lightweight design and low energy consumption, LED strip lighting has gained significant popularity among homeowners and designers alike. Furthermore, the ability to customize lengths and configurations means that these strips can be tailored to fit any unique space, ensuring that every corner of a room can be beautifully illuminated without the clutter of traditional fixtures.
The Basics of LED Tape Strip Lighting
At its core, LED tape strip lighting consists of several LED chips mounted on a flexible circuit board. Typically, these strips are available in lengths of 5 meters, though they can be cut to fit specific needs. The LED chips emit light when an electric current passes through them, providing brightness while consuming minimal power. The efficiency of LED technology not only reduces electricity bills but also contributes to a lower carbon footprint, making it an environmentally friendly choice.
Moreover, most LED tape strips are available in various color temperatures, ranging from warm white to cool white, allowing users to create the desired ambiance in their spaces. The brightness of LED tape lights is measured in lumens, and higher lumens indicate brighter light output. In addition to color temperature, some strips offer tunable white options, enabling users to adjust the color temperature throughout the day, mimicking natural daylight and enhancing well-being.

The Science Behind LED Lighting
Understanding how LED lights work involves delving into the science of semiconductor technology. LEDs, or Light Emitting Diodes, utilize a semiconductor material that emits light when an electric current passes through it. This process is known as electroluminescence.
Unlike traditional light bulbs that use filaments or gas to generate light, LEDs convert almost all the electrical energy they consume into light with minimal heat production, making them energy-efficient. This unique property allows LEDs to last significantly longer than incandescent or fluorescent alternatives, often exceeding 25,000 hours of use.
How LED Lights Work
When electricity travels through the LED chip, electrons recombine with holes within the semiconductor material, releasing energy in the form of light. The color of the emitted light is determined by the energy gap of the semiconductor materials used. For instance, aluminum gallium indium phosphide (AlGaInP) is often used for red and yellow LEDs, while indium gallium nitride (InGaN) is suitable for blue and green LEDs.
This technology not only enhances efficiency but also minimizes the likelihood of burnout and failure, allowing LEDs to maintain performance over time without the rapid decrease in brightness typical of other lighting technologies. The compact size of LEDs also opens up a world of possibilities in design and application, enabling their use in everything from intricate decorative lighting to robust industrial applications.
Benefits of LED Lighting
The advantages of LED lighting are manifold. Firstly, the energy efficiency of LEDs significantly reduces electricity costs compared to traditional lighting options, making them a sustainable choice. Secondly, their long lifespan translates to lower maintenance and replacement costs.
In addition to cost savings, LED lighting contributes to environmental conservation as they contain no harmful substances like mercury, often found in fluorescent bulbs. It also generates less heat, creating a safer environment, particularly in confined spaces where heat could pose risks. The durability of LEDs also means they are less prone to breakage, which is especially beneficial in high-traffic areas or outdoor settings where traditional bulbs might fail more frequently.
Furthermore, the flexibility in design provided by LED tape strips enables innovative uses, allowing homeowners and designers to enhance aesthetics while enjoying functional lighting solutions. The ability to dim LEDs and change colors has made them a favorite in modern interior design, where mood lighting can be adjusted to suit various occasions. Additionally, advancements in smart technology have led to the integration of LEDs with smart home systems, allowing users to control their lighting remotely, schedule on/off times, and even sync lights with music for a dynamic ambiance.

Installation Process for LED Tape Strip Lighting
Installing LED tape strip lighting can be a straightforward process if you follow the right steps. By understanding the installation process, users can ensure a hassle-free setup and maximize the benefits of their lighting choice.
Tools Needed for Installation
Before starting, gather the following tools: a measuring tape, scissors (for cutting strips), a power supply or driver suitable for your LED tape lights, adhesive mounts or clips (if necessary), and optionally, a soldering iron if connecting multiple strips or making custom installations.
Having these tools ready not only simplifies the process but also aids in achieving clean and professional-looking results.
Step-by-Step Installation Guide
- Measure the Area: Use a measuring tape to determine the length of tape you need, factoring in any cuts or bends that may be required.
- Cut the Strip: If needed, cut the LED strip at designated points, which are usually marked every few inches.
- Prepare the Surface: Ensure the surface is clean and dry for effective adhesion, removing any debris or oil.
- Peel and Stick: Remove the adhesive backing from the LED tape and press it onto the surface firmly, ensuring there are no gaps.
- Connect to Power: Attach the LED strip to the power supply, usually through simple connectors, or use soldering for more permanent installations.
- Test the Lights: Before finalizing, turn on the power to ensure the lights work appropriately. Adjust any positioning as necessary.
Maintenance and Troubleshooting of LED Tape Strip Lighting
Proper maintenance and troubleshooting procedures can prolong the life and functionality of your LED tape strip lights. Awareness of common issues is essential for ensuring they operate efficiently.
Common Issues and Their Solutions
Some common issues users may encounter include flickering lights, uneven brightness, or inoperability. Flickering can often be attributed to insufficient power supply or loose connections, while uneven brightness may arise from uneven power distribution across the strips.
To resolve these issues, check all connections, ensure the power supply meets the requirements of the total length of LED strip, and consider using a larger gauge wire for longer runs. In cases of complete inoperability, testing individual sections may help identify malfunctioning segments.
Tips for Prolonging the Life of Your LED Tape Strip Lights
To maximize the life of LED tape lights, consider implementing the following tips:
- Ensure proper heat dissipation by avoiding direct contact with materials that can retain heat.
- Use a suitable driver and avoid exceeding the recommended power ratings.
- Keep the lights away from moisture-prone areas unless using waterproof-rated strips.
- Regularly check connections and power supplies for wear and tear.
By following these guidelines, you can ensure your LED tape strip lighting continues to shine brightly for years to come, adding charm and functionality to any space.
